STEP 1: Graduation Application/Audit Process

The graduation application/audit requests are reviewed as listed below. Once a graduate has been cleared, a party hat icon ๐ŸŽ‰ appears in DegreeWorks, and you receive an email notification from the HCC Student Records Office.

Fall 2025: graduates will begin to be cleared for graduation in October and notified by November 10, 2025.

Spring 2026 graduates will begin to be cleared for graduation in February and notified by April 7, 2026.

Summer 2026 graduates will begin to be cleared for graduation after April 7 and notified after April 7, 2026.

If you believe you should be graduating and do not see the icon or receive an email by the deadline, please submit a graduation application/audit request.

Graduation is contingent upon the successful completion of all degree/certificate requirements.

On Commencement Day

All graduation candidates are invited to attend Commencement! Whether you are earning a degree or certificate. Fall 2025, Spring 2026, or Summer 2026 graduates are all welcome to celebrate this milestone.  

Seating is unlimited, so bring your entire support system to cheer you on! CONGRATULATIONS!

The Convention Center CarPark parking garage, adjacent to the venue, is now open! However, construction activities will continue in and around the garage. Please follow all signage and directions provided by the garage attendants.  

Entrances and exits are located on Harrison Avenue & Dwight Street. Please be aware that there is a $10 parking fee if you choose this option, and MassMutual will not validate parking. Please note: Bruce Landon Way is partially shut down due to the construction of the new garage, so there is no through traffic. However, there is limited ADA parking on Dwight Street, State Street, and Court Street. As always, MGM offers free parking. Please park, take the elevator to the casino floor, and follow the floor arrow signs stating The Under 21 Expressway to the MassMutual Center. This will bring you through the casino (without entering the casino floor) to an exit. Upon exiting, the MassMutual Center will be across the street to your left. 

Please remember that outside food, drinks, balloons, or air horns are not allowed in the MassMutual Center, and all bags will be checked by their staff.
